摘要
Properties of nuclear matter below the nuclear saturation density is analyzed by molecular dynamics (MD) simulations with the periodic boundary condition. The equation of state at these densities is softened by the formation of cluster(s) with internal density nearly equal to the saturation density. The structure of nuclear matter shows some exotic shapes with variation of the density. Furthermore, it is found that the symmetry parameter a(sym)(p) is not a linear function of density at low density region.
